
This simulation models the batch decomposition of acetylated castor oil to drying oil and acetic acid vapour. The reaction is endothermic, and heat transfer to the reactor is required in order to accomplish the decomposition of the acetylated oil, to liberate acetic acid vapor.
Assumptions
The model here treats the process as occuring at constant reactor mass, although actually some mass is lost via the acetic acid vapor.
The effect of temperature and composition on the value of specific heat capacity is ignored. However, this can be taken into account by modelling a block for Cp(T, composition).
Data values used for this model are based on those used by Froment & Bischoff |
